Unmarked Territory Possibly is?
Perhaps the area is the province described in Tuarhaivel (the elf domain
sourcebook) as being possessed technically by the gorgon but in
actuality is a shadowworld overrun province commanded by the elf
wizard "the Lich". I do not have the domain sourcebook in front of me,
but it described the gorgon attempting to overrun the province and the
lich tapping into the shadowworld to destroy all living things in the
province (at the expense of destroying elves, deer, rabbits, kerpca) ;)
